What is custom AI development?

Custom AI development is the design and construction of AI systems built specifically for one organization’s processes, data and systems, rather than configuring a general-purpose product. It suits problems where the workflow, data structure or compliance requirements are specific enough that no commercial product fits, and it results in software the client owns outright.

Right Fit

When custom beats buying

The honest test is whether your requirement is genuinely unusual. Support deflection, meeting summarization and document extraction are common problems with good products; if that is your need, buy it and we will say so.

Custom earns its cost when the process is proprietary, when integration with a legacy system is the hard part, when data cannot leave your infrastructure, or when per-seat licensing becomes more expensive than owning the software.

  • Processes specific enough that no product covers the important part
  • Requirements to integrate with legacy systems products will not touch
  • Data residency or compliance rules that rule out SaaS deployment
  • Volume where per-seat or per-transaction licensing exceeds build cost
  • AI capability that forms part of your own product or competitive position
  • Organizations that have already tried products and hit a specific wall

Illustrative project scenario

Illustrative project scenario

Specialty insurer · proprietary underwriting

Building what no underwriting product could replicate

Challenge. A specialty insurer underwrote unusual risks using judgement built over thirty years, encoded nowhere except in three senior underwriters. Commercial underwriting platforms assumed standard risk categories that did not apply. Two of the three underwriters were within five years of retirement.

What we built. A custom system combining structured historical policy and claims data with retrieval over three decades of underwriting notes and decisions. It produces a risk assessment with the comparable historical cases cited, plus an explicit confidence level. Every recommendation is advisory: an underwriter makes the decision, and their agreement or override is captured as further training signal.

Outcome. Junior underwriters now produce assessments materially closer to senior judgement, measured by override rate. Quote turnaround fell from an average of six days to under one. Critically, the reasoning behind three decades of decisions is now documented and queryable rather than resident in three people.
